OpenTAP for network monitoring by DIDcomms

OpenTAP Gateway is a Telocator Alphanumeric Protocol (TAP) to SMS and Email gateway messaging service provider. Since OpenTAP uses trusted equipment, a standard phone line and dialup modem, TAP is by far the most reliable way to send full-text messages to your cellular phone.
